Leadership Review Briefing — Incoming Director

Subject: Closure of the Dornholt satellite office.

Headcount: nine. Seven accept relocation to Brassfield; two take severance. Lease ends in four months; landlord has agreed to early exit terms. Client coverage transfers to the Keldway team with no service gap expected. Announcement sequencing: staff first, then key accounts, then general notice. Tomas Vehr handles logistics; you own communications. Costs land within the approved envelope. Read the appended note before any external conversation.

management briefing: The pricing group signed off on a budget of $378.8 million for Project Kasael.

Finance Review Summary — Inventory Write-Down

Branch managers: Q2 close includes a write-down on the Fenwick line of surplus Corvale-series components. Demand fell after the Tarbin contract lapsed; units are obsolete against the new spec. Impact absorbed at group level; branch targets unchanged. Dispose of remaining stock per the salvage schedule. No discounting without regional approval. Report remaining Corvale counts by month-end. The confidential note on related business plans is appended below.

management briefing: Istaelix Group is in early talks to buy Sorysax Logistics for about $496.2 million. The Kasox launch date is October 3, and nothing goes to the press before then. Legal wants the Norokax Foods term sheet withdrawn before April 25.

Migration step 4: Report exports in Quartzline now emit timestamps in UTC, not the tenant's local zone. Update any downstream parsers before Thursday's cutover. Legacy exports from the Branwick cluster stay unchanged until deprecation. Verify the offset flag is set per environment. The current export service settings are as follows.

deployment values, taweg-bajop:
[fenvan]
port = 5672
team = holmir
host = fenvan.orvexio.example
region = lower-1
access_code = ac_b98bc6
timeout_ms = 1500

## Password Reset Revamp — Runbook Fragment (for weekly eng sync)

The new Fernwick reset flow replaces emailed codes with short-lived tokens stored in the auth sidecar. Rollout is gated behind the `reset_v2` flag, currently at 25%. If token validation errors spike, flip the flag off and drain the sidecar queue before retrying. Verification requires querying the token table directly from the bastion. Connect to the auth database using the connection string on the following line.

replica DSN, kajep-yahag: mssql://praok_svc:iF@db-8d68.plorvaio.local:5432/eliion